[0025] The technical solutions of the present invention will be further described below in conjunction with the accompanying drawings and embodiments.

[0026] Such as figure 1 As shown, it is a flowchart of a seamless splicing display method in the present invention. A seamless splicing display method, comprising mutually spliced ​​display units, the specific steps are:

[0027] Step S1: moving the pixels from the center of the display unit to the edge of the display area from the center of the display unit to the edge of the display unit;

[0028] When the pixel is moved, the pixel is moved in the unit of a single row / column or the moving distance is incremented in the unit of multiple rows / column of pixels.

Abstract

The invention relates to a splicing display technology, and in particular relates to a seamless splicing display method and device. The seamless splicing display method comprises mutually-spliced display units. The seamless splicing display method comprises the step of moving pixels ranging from the centers of the display units to the edges of display regions along the direction from the centers of the display units to the edges of the display units, wherein pixel gaps are formed among the pixels according to differences of moving distances, and the pixels on the edges of the display regions of the display units cover frames of the display units after being moved. According to the invention, the pixels on the display units are moved for a certain distance along the direction from the centers to the edges, the pixels from the centers to the edges gradually increase the moving distance during moving, thus the pixel gaps are formed among the pixels, so that the pixels on the edges of the display regions of the display units just cover the frames of the display units after being moved, problems of the frames and the splicing gaps during splicing of the display units are effectively solved, continuity and integrity of displayed images among the display units are well ensured, and a better watching effect is achieved.

technical field [0001] The present invention relates to splicing display technology, in particular to a seamless splicing display method and device. Background technique [0002] With the improvement of people's demand for display information transmission, the application fields of large-screen display have spread to various fields such as public display, transportation dispatching and commanding, weather monitoring, power and telecommunications monitoring, fire monitoring and commanding, and military commanding. Existing large-screen display technologies mainly combine multiple display units for splicing and display by stacking. The advantage of splicing large screens is that it can improve the display resolution of the system, increase the display area, realize the display of a complete picture on the entire display screen, and open windows at any position on the display screen.
